   35 #ifndef _NETINET_TCP_DEBUG_H_
   36 #define _NETINET_TCP_DEBUG_H_
   37 
   38 /*
   39  * Tcp+ip header, after ip options removed.
   40  */
   41 struct tcpiphdr {
   42         struct  ipovly ti_i;            /* overlaid ip structure */
   43         struct  tcphdr ti_t;            /* tcp header */
   44 };
   45 #define ti_x1           ti_i.ih_x1
   46 #define ti_pr           ti_i.ih_pr
   47 #define ti_len          ti_i.ih_len
   48 #define ti_src          ti_i.ih_src
   49 #define ti_dst          ti_i.ih_dst
   50 #define ti_sport        ti_t.th_sport
   51 #define ti_dport        ti_t.th_dport
   52 #define ti_seq          ti_t.th_seq
   53 #define ti_ack          ti_t.th_ack
   54 #define ti_x2           ti_t.th_x2
   55 #define ti_off          ti_t.th_off
   56 #define ti_flags        ti_t.th_flags
   57 #define ti_win          ti_t.th_win
   58 #define ti_sum          ti_t.th_sum
   59 #define ti_urp          ti_t.th_urp
   60 
   61 struct tcpipv6hdr {
   62         struct ip6_hdr ti6_i;
   63         struct tcphdr ti6_t;
   64 };
   65 
   66 #define ti6_src         ti6_i.ip6_src
   67 #define ti6_dst         ti6_i.ip6_dst
   68 #define ti6_plen        ti6_i.ip6_plen
   69 #define ti6_sport       ti6_t.th_sport
   70 #define ti6_dport       ti6_t.th_dport
   71 #define ti6_seq         ti6_t.th_seq
   72 #define ti6_ack         ti6_t.th_ack
   73 #define ti6_x2          ti6_t.th_x2
   74 #define ti6_off         ti6_t.th_off
   75 #define ti6_flags       ti6_t.th_flags
   76 #define ti6_win         ti6_t.th_win
   77 #define ti6_sum         ti6_t.th_sum
   78 #define ti6_urp         ti6_t.th_urp
   79 
   80 struct  tcp_debug {
   81         uint32_t td_time;
   82         short   td_act;
   83         short   td_ostate;
   84         caddr_t td_tcb;
   85         struct  tcpiphdr td_ti;
   86         struct  tcpipv6hdr td_ti6;
   87         short   td_req;
   88         struct  tcpcb td_cb;
   89 };
   90 
   91 #define TA_INPUT        0
   92 #define TA_OUTPUT       1
   93 #define TA_USER         2
   94 #define TA_RESPOND      3
   95 #define TA_DROP         4
   96 #define TA_TIMER        5
   97 
   98 #ifdef TANAMES
   99 const char *tanames[] =
  100     { "input", "output", "user", "respond", "drop", "timer" };
  101 #endif /* TANAMES */
  102 
  103 #define TCP_NDEBUG 100
  104 extern struct   tcp_debug tcp_debug[];
  105 extern int      tcp_debx;
  106 #endif /* _NETINET_TCP_DEBUG_H_ */
